Jharsuguda, Odisha: Jharsuguda Airport Police arrested two youths of Talpatia, Shubham G. (24) and Abhishek Singh (26), for running an extortion racket targeting truck drivers near Durlaga Chowk on State Highway 10. During a routine night patrol, officers received a tip-off that two men were threatening truck drivers with a knife and demanding cash. Acting immediately, the police rushed to the spot and caught the duo red-handed while they tried to extort money.
The police recovered ₹1,500 in cash, a knife (bhujali) used in the crime, and a motorbike that the suspects used for their operation. Investigators questioned both accused, who confessed to their involvement in similar extortion attempts across the area.
After registering a case, the police took the accused to court the same day. Officials said the Jharsuguda Police remain determined to crush such criminal networks and keep the highways safe for transporters and residents alike.
